Pecans on Fire

Ignite your taste buds with "Pecans on Fire," the ultimate sweet-and-spicy snack that’s both dangerously addictive and delightfully simple to make! This recipe combines the earthy richness of raw pecan halves with a bold glaze of melted butter, brown sugar, maple syrup, and the perfect blend of cayenne pepper, smoked paprika, cinnamon, and sea salt. Roasted to caramelized perfection in under 15 minutes, these spiced nuts deliver an irresistible crunch with a smoky, fiery kick that’s balanced by a touch of sweetness. Prep Time:10 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:25 mins
Servings: 6

Ingredients

  • 2 cups raw pecan halves
  • 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on maple syrup
  • 0.5 teaspoons cayenne pepper
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 0.5 teaspoons sea sal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ons ground cinnamon

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.

Step 2

In a small saucepan, melt the unsalted butter over low heat.

Step 3

Stir in the brown sugar, maple syrup, cayenne pepper, smoked paprika, sea salt, and ground cinnamon until fully combined and smooth. Remove from heat.

Step 4

Place the raw pecan halves in a large mixing bowl. Pour the butter and spice mixture over the pecans and toss well to ensure every pecan is evenly coated.

Step 5

Spread the coated pecans evenly on the prepared baking sheet in a single layer.

Step 6

Roast the pecans in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, stirring halfway through to prevent burning and to ensure even caramelization.

Step 7

Remove the pecans from the oven and allow them to cool completely on the baking sheet. They will become crisp as they cool.

Step 8

Once cooled, transfer the pecans to an airtight container for storage or serve immediately. Enjoy your Pecans on Fire as a snack or as a topping for salads and desserts!
